Hi,

On 30/10/2019 14:43, Fabrizio Castro wrote:
> lvds-encoder.c implementation is also suitable for LVDS decoders,
> not just LVDS encoders.
> Instead of creating a new driver for addressing support for
> transparent LVDS decoders, repurpose lvds-encoder.c for the greater
> good.
> 
> Signed-off-by: Fabrizio Castro <fabrizio.castro@bp.renesas.com>
> ---
>  drivers/gpu/drm/bridge/Kconfig        |   8 +-
>  drivers/gpu/drm/bridge/Makefile       |   2 +-
>  drivers/gpu/drm/bridge/lvds-codec.c   | 169 ++++++++++++++++++++++++++++++++++
>  drivers/gpu/drm/bridge/lvds-encoder.c | 155 -------------------------------
>  4 files changed, 174 insertions(+), 160 deletions(-)
>  create mode 100644 drivers/gpu/drm/bridge/lvds-codec.c
>  delete mode 100644 drivers/gpu/drm/bridge/lvds-encoder.c
> 
> diff --git a/drivers/gpu/drm/bridge/Kconfig b/drivers/gpu/drm/bridge/Kconfig
> index 3436297..9e75ca4e 100644
> --- a/drivers/gpu/drm/bridge/Kconfig
> +++ b/drivers/gpu/drm/bridge/Kconfig
> @@ -45,14 +45,14 @@ config DRM_DUMB_VGA_DAC
>  	  Support for non-programmable RGB to VGA DAC bridges, such as ADI
>  	  ADV7123, TI THS8134 and THS8135 or passive resistor ladder DACs.
>  
> -config DRM_LVDS_ENCODER
> -	tristate "Transparent parallel to LVDS encoder support"
> +config DRM_LVDS_CODEC


I'm not CCed on other patches, but I'm pretty sure you should fix other
Kconfig and defconfigs selecting this config in this patch to avoid breaking bisect.

Neil

> +	tristate "Transparent LVDS encoders and decoders support"
>  	depends on OF
>  	select DRM_KMS_HELPER
>  	select DRM_PANEL_BRIDGE
>  	help
> -	  Support for transparent parallel to LVDS encoders that don't require
> -	  any configuration.
> +	  Support for transparent LVDS encoders and LVDS decoders that don't
> +	  require any configuration.
>

> diff --git a/drivers/gpu/drm/bridge/lvds-codec.c b/drivers/gpu/drm/bridge/lvds-codec.c
> new file mode 100644
> index 0000000..8a1979c
> --- /dev/null
> +++ b/drivers/gpu/drm/bridge/lvds-codec.c
> @@ -0,0 +1,169 @@
> +// SPDX-License-Identifier: GPL-2.0-or-later
> +/*
> + * Copyright (C) 2016 Laurent Pinchart <laurent.pinchart@ideasonboard.com>
> + */
> +
> +#include <linux/gpio/consumer.h>
> +#include <linux/module.h>
> +#include <linux/of.h>
> +#include <linux/of_device.h>
> +#include <linux/of_graph.h>
> +#include <linux/platform_device.h>
> +
> +#include <drm/drm_bridge.h>
> +#include <drm/drm_panel.h>
> +
> +struct lvds_codec {
> +	struct drm_bridge bridge;
> +	struct drm_bridge *panel_bridge;
> +	struct gpio_desc *powerdown_gpio;
> +	u32 connector_type;
> +};
> +
> +static int lvds_codec_attach(struct drm_bridge *bridge)
> +{
> +	struct lvds_codec *lvds_codec = container_of(bridge,
> +							 struct lvds_codec,
> +							 bridge);
> +
> +	return drm_bridge_attach(bridge->encoder, lvds_codec->panel_bridge,
> +				 bridge);
> +}
> +
> +static void lvds_codec_enable(struct drm_bridge *bridge)
> +{
> +	struct lvds_codec *lvds_codec = container_of(bridge,
> +							 struct lvds_codec,
> +							 bridge);
> +
> +	if (lvds_codec->powerdown_gpio)
> +		gpiod_set_value_cansleep(lvds_codec->powerdown_gpio, 0);
> +}
> +
> +static void lvds_codec_disable(struct drm_bridge *bridge)
> +{
> +	struct lvds_codec *lvds_codec = container_of(bridge,
> +							 struct lvds_codec,
> +							 bridge);
> +
> +	if (lvds_codec->powerdown_gpio)
> +		gpiod_set_value_cansleep(lvds_codec->powerdown_gpio, 1);
> +}
> +
> +static struct drm_bridge_funcs funcs = {
> +	.attach = lvds_codec_attach,
> +	.enable = lvds_codec_enable,
> +	.disable = lvds_codec_disable,
> +};
> +
> +static int lvds_codec_probe(struct platform_device *pdev)
> +{
> +	struct device *dev = &pdev->dev;
> +	struct device_node *port;
> +	struct device_node *endpoint;
> +	struct device_node *panel_node;
> +	struct drm_panel *panel;
> +	struct lvds_codec *lvds_codec;
> +
> +	lvds_codec = devm_kzalloc(dev, sizeof(*lvds_codec), GFP_KERNEL);
> +	if (!lvds_codec)
> +		return -ENOMEM;
> +
> +	lvds_codec->connector_type = (u32)
> +		of_device_get_match_data(&pdev->dev);
> +	lvds_codec->powerdown_gpio = devm_gpiod_get_optional(dev, "powerdown",
> +							       GPIOD_OUT_HIGH);
> +	if (IS_ERR(lvds_codec->powerdown_gpio)) {
> +		int err = PTR_ERR(lvds_codec->powerdown_gpio);
> +
> +		if (err != -EPROBE_DEFER)
> +			dev_err(dev, "powerdown GPIO failure: %d\n", err);
> +		return err;
> +	}
> +
> +	/* Locate the panel DT node. */
> +	port = of_graph_get_port_by_id(dev->of_node, 1);
> +	if (!port) {
> +		dev_dbg(dev, "port 1 not found\n");
> +		return -ENXIO;
> +	}
> +
> +	endpoint = of_get_child_by_name(port, "endpoint");
> +	of_node_put(port);
> +	if (!endpoint) {
> +		dev_dbg(dev, "no endpoint for port 1\n");
> +		return -ENXIO;
> +	}
> +
> +	panel_node = of_graph_get_remote_port_parent(endpoint);
> +	of_node_put(endpoint);
> +	if (!panel_node) {
> +		dev_dbg(dev, "no remote endpoint for port 1\n");
> +		return -ENXIO;
> +	}
> +
> +	panel = of_drm_find_panel(panel_node);
> +	of_node_put(panel_node);
> +	if (IS_ERR(panel)) {
> +		dev_dbg(dev, "panel not found, deferring probe\n");
> +		return PTR_ERR(panel);
> +	}
> +
> +	lvds_codec->panel_bridge =
> +		devm_drm_panel_bridge_add_typed(dev, panel,
> +						lvds_codec->connector_type);
> +	if (IS_ERR(lvds_codec->panel_bridge))
> +		return PTR_ERR(lvds_codec->panel_bridge);
> +
> +	/* The panel_bridge bridge is attached to the panel's of_node,
> +	 * but we need a bridge attached to our of_node for our user
> +	 * to look up.
> +	 */
> +	lvds_codec->bridge.of_node = dev->of_node;
> +	lvds_codec->bridge.funcs = &funcs;
> +	drm_bridge_add(&lvds_codec->bridge);
> +
> +	platform_set_drvdata(pdev, lvds_codec);
> +
> +	return 0;
> +}
> +
> +static int lvds_codec_remove(struct platform_device *pdev)
> +{
> +	struct lvds_codec *lvds_codec = platform_get_drvdata(pdev);
> +
> +	drm_bridge_remove(&lvds_codec->bridge);
> +
> +	return 0;
> +}
> +
> +static const struct of_device_id lvds_codec_match[] = {
> +	{
> +		.compatible = "lvds-encoder",
> +		.data = (void *)DRM_MODE_CONNECTOR_LVDS
> +	},
> +	{
> +		.compatible = "thine,thc63lvdm83d",
> +		.data = (void *)DRM_MODE_CONNECTOR_LVDS,
> +	},
> +	{
> +		.compatible = "lvds-decoder",
> +		.data = (void *)DRM_MODE_CONNECTOR_Unknown,
> +	},
> +	{},
> +};
> +MODULE_DEVICE_TABLE(of, lvds_codec_match);
> +
> +static struct platform_driver lvds_codec_driver = {
> +	.probe	= lvds_codec_probe,
> +	.remove	= lvds_codec_remove,
> +	.driver		= {
> +		.name		= "lvds-codec",
> +		.of_match_table	= lvds_codec_match,
> +	},
> +};
> +module_platform_driver(lvds_codec_driver);
> +
> +MODULE_AUTHOR("Laurent Pinchart <laurent.pinchart@ideasonboard.com>");
> +MODULE_DESCRIPTION("Driver for transparent LVDS encoders and LVDS decoders");
> +MODULE_LICENSE("GPL");
